THE CHALLENGE
Sewa Eco is a non-profit organization built on the philosophy of service before self. Working at the community level, they collect and recycle electronics and machinery that would otherwise go to waste and redirect these resources toward people who need them most. Guided by values of transparency, reliability, and sincerity, they came to us needing help getting organized. With a growing volunteer base and expanding operations, they needed clearer structure, stronger systems, and a more consistent public presence to sustain their mission long-term.

THE WORK
Structured team roles and accountability systems — clear responsibilities assigned to each volunteer with defined weekly task expectations
Technology infrastructure setup using Google Workspace and Notion — centralized task tracking, event calendars, and shared volunteer dashboards
Digital marketing and outreach systems — website setup on Wix, branded Canva templates, and managed Instagram and Facebook accounts with weekly posting
Revenue and sustainability planning — donation system setup, grant research support, sponsorship outreach strategy, and revenue tracking frameworks
